Add 9/18 and 63/35

1st number: 9/18, 2nd number: 1 28/35

9/18 + 63/35 is 23/10.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 18 and 35 is 630

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 630
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 18 × 35 = 630,
    9/18 = 9 × 35/18 × 35 = 315/630
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 35 × 18 = 630,
    63/35 = 63 × 18/35 × 18 = 1134/630
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    315/630 + 1134/630 = 315 + 1134/630 = 1449/630
  5. 1449/630 simplified gives 23/10
  6. So, 9/18 + 63/35 = 23/10
    In mixed form: 23/10
